Epilepsy: How VNS Therapy Gave My Daughter’s Life Back to Her, Mike Knox 11.04.2023

Mike Knox is an author, caregiver and father to a child who has drug-resistant epilepsy. Mike’s daughter, Vivien, started having seizures before she turned two and is now six years seizure-free using VNS Therapy, which is a medical device designed to prevent seizures before they start and stop them if they do.
